Output 9508f626cd1fd33247d59ca1b6e1be61310371111e56747d999c0326e20027cb:1

value
586425
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9e67dc626e707ec3a5b156a782212e94e3b61028 OP_EQUALVERIFY OP_CHECKSIG
address
1FSaBgzJajaANTFQd8MjPgVpLzqY9qUJqx
transaction
9508f626cd1fd33247d59ca1b6e1be61310371111e56747d999c0326e20027cb
confirmations
324785
spent
true